Melvin Charles Baleme a native of Merced was born to James and Zilpha Baleme on August 17, 1927. He passed away February 16, 2006 at the age of 78. Mel worked for over 30 years as a heavy equipment operator in construction. He loved the outdoors. He enjoyed camping, boating and fishing. Mel was a great fan of the San Francisco Giants and the 49ers. He was a member of the Merced Eagles Club, the Merced Elks Lodge and Operating Engineer Local #3. Mel was loved and will be greatly missed by family and friends. Preceded in death by his first wife Birdie and his wife Toadie, his parents, four brothers and a sister, he is survived by stepdaughters, Dee Munoz and her husband Joe and Vicky Chavez and her husband Larry. He has four step- grandsons and 6 great step-grandchildren. He is also survived by nieces and nephews. Visitation will be held Tuesday, February 21, 2006 from 4:00 to 7:00 P.M. at Whitton Family Funeral Service, 740 W. 19th St. in Merced. Funeral services will be held Wednesday, February 22, 2006 at 1:00 P.M. at Calvary Assembly of God church, 1021 "R" St. In Merced. Burial will follow at Merced District Cemetery. Arrangements are under the direction of Whitton Family Funeral Service.
~ Merced Sun Star, 21 Feb 2006
